China will limit coal use to curb air pollution

Releases plan to cap coal consumption.

The plan will limit coal consumption to below 65% of China’s total primary energy use by 2017. The government said pressure to curb air pollution is rising amid China's industrialization and urbanization and increasing consumption of energy and resources.

According to the plan, new industrial projects in the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ei region in north China, the Yangtze Delta region in the east and the Pearl River Delta region in the south will be banned from building their own captive power plants.

These regions will also be encouraged to replace coal use with power purchased from other areas or with power generated from natural gas or non-fossil fuels such as nuclear power.
